#688eb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#688eb5 is composed of 40.8% red, 55.7%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.5%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 210.4 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 55.9%. #688eb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#001d6b.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#688eb5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#688eb5 has RGB values of R:104, G:142,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6852277.

Shades and Tints of #688eb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030507 is the darkest color, while #f9f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#688eb5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8e92 is the less saturated color, while #238dfa is the most saturated one.
